Philosophy Eddy Merckx


The Eddy Merckx Company was created in 1980, just 3 years after Eddy stopped racing. It was an opportunity to get back into the business he loved, and the world he knew most about. The company started in an old farmhouse in Meise, near Brussels and little by little started producing top of the range racing bicycles. Almost 30 years on, it is preparing itself to move into much larger premises, with new facilities, new machines and an amazing new showroom.
One thing however hasn't changed, namely the attention to detail and love of bikes that everyone in the company shares.
Eddy has always been obsessed with bikes - in fact it wasn't unusual for him to get up in the middle of the night to change something on his handlebars or gears. Position, fit and feel are incredibly important for him - on his own bike and on those of others too. This innate understanding of how a bike should be - a result of talent and many years of experience - is key for the design of every Eddy Merckx bicycle.

About Louis
Louis Garneau has been involved with cycling his entire life. With 13 years of bike racing around the globe, over 150 victories, and winning the Canadian Championship in individual pursuit, Louis Garneau correlated his career through his passion for cycling.
In the fall of 1983, in his father's garage, Louis Garneau, the president founder and his wife Monique Arsenault, started manufacturing their first cycling clothes. In 1984, after participating in the Los Angeles Olympic Games, the manager-owner decided to leave active competition and turn to business. The couple's extensive experience in cycling made them well aware of cyclists' specific needs and enabled them to develop a range of original and comfortable clothing offered at competitive prices.

  • 1983 - Louis Garneau, the president founder and his wife Monique Arsenault, started manufacturing their first cycling clothes in his father's garage.
  • 1984 - Louis Garneau moves to boulevard Charest a Sainte-Foy and employs five people.
  • 1985 - Louis Garneau continues to grow and relocates to rue Dalton a Sainte-Foy and production grows to sixteen employees.
  • 1988 - In just five years, Louis Garneau Sports grew from one employee to 118 employees, a garage to a 32,000 square foot building, and local distribution had proliferated to national distribution throughout Canada.
  • 1988 - Louis Garneau embarks on the helmet market.  A market that eventually, Louis Garneau will grow to become a leader of.
  • 1989 - Merely a catalyst for the future, in 1989, Louis Garneau crossed the border and embarked on the US market with the opening of the first US office in Newport, VT.
  • 1991 - After modest helmet sales in 1989, tremendous sale increases and an export market breakthrough happened in 1990. Export market grew to over 20 distributors worldwide.
  • 1993- Factory in Saint-Augustin undergoes further expansion to house over 150 employees.

  • 1996- Louis Garneau is voted CANADA'S 50 BEST MANAGED PRIVATE COMPANIES sponsored by Advantage, Canadian, The Financial Post & Arthur Andersen
  • 1997- Louis Garneau launches a website and embarks on the world wide web.
  • 1998- Hydrowear Jersey, able to hold a bladder from any hydration system-no backpack required, is voted Editor's Choice by Bicycling
  • 2000- Louis Garneau sponsors Saturn Professional Cycling Team whose roster consisted of cycling greats such as Ivan DOMINGUEZTim JOHNSONMark MCCORMACKLyne BESSETTEMichael BARRY, Chris WHERRY.
  • 2000- Official Apparel and Helmet Sponsor of Saturn Professional Cycling whose roster consisted of cycling greats such as Ivan DOMINGUEZTim JOHNSONMark MCCORMACKLyne BESSETTEMichael BARRYChris WHERRY.
  • 2002- First on the market with a legal TT helmet, the Prologue Helmet.
  • 2002- Patented Ergo Air Concept Introduced
  • 2003- Beginning of a 5 year sponsorship with the Jittery  Professional Cycling Team launching the Head to Toe Cycling Solution.
  • 2004- Start of sponsorship of Pro Triathlete,Chris Legh.  This sponsorship continues on today.
  • 2006- Gemini Jacket is voted Bicycling Editor's Choice.
  • 2007- Sponsored Bouygues-Telecom Professional Cycling Team with helmets. 
  • 2009- Sponsorship of Team Type 1 which included a Men's and Women's Pro Team, RAAM Team, and Triathlon Team.
  • 2009- Sponsorship of Rock Racing Professional Cycling Team with helmets and shoes debuted at the Tour of California.
  • 2009- Louis Garneau launches a snowshoe collection for the US Market for Winter 2010.
  • 2010- Louis Garneau announces their worldwide sponsorship of teamTBB, a Singapore-based team. Team TBB is a major player in professional triathlon, representing and managing 30 athletes of 15 nationalities.
  • 2010- Louis Garneau sponsors of the Bahati Foundation Pro Cycling Team. The Bahati Foundation, founded by Rahsaan Bahati, is a non-profit organization that inspires and empowers underprivileged youth to rise above their circumstances.
  • 2010- Louis Garneau announces a three year helmet sponsorship with the current 3X Successive Ironman Champion and Course Record Breaker, Chrissie Wellington.
  • 2010- Winner of the Editors' Choice Award for Best Women's Short Under $100 USD by Bicycling Magazine.

THIS IS THE STORY OF A LITTLE KID RIDING HIS VERY FIRST BIKE RACE
This is the story of a combative little kid riding his very first bike race. His bike is nothing special; heavy, a mass-produced clunker with fat tires. The kid looks kinda funny too. This being Canada, he’s borrowed a buddy’s hockey helmet to ride the race, a race he ends up winning. It’s 1973 and the kid’s name is Gervais Rioux and he’s about to discover a whole new world, the wonderful world of cycling and he decides right there and then that he is going to make that world his. A few years later, he witnesses the 1976 Olympics in Montreal and there’s no turning back now, his path is set: he too must reach the topmost rung of the ladder, the pinnacle of cycling achievement, pushing the envelope to the limit.


ONE OF THE MOST SUCCESSFUL NORTH-AMERICAN RACERS OF HIS GENERATION
The kid turned out to be one of the most successful North-American racers of his generation, with 150 or so victories in America and Europe. The list includes three Canadian road racing champion titles, three Quebec road championships, a win at Grand Prix de Beauce, a Tour of Luxembourg, a Tour of Nevada. While a member of prestigious, powerful squads such as Ten Speed Drive and Evian-Miko, Gervais Rioux also represented Canada in major international events for over a decade, such as the Commonwealth Games in 1982 and the 1988 Olympics in Seoul.



A VISION OF CYCLING
Throughout his racing career, three personal traits defined Gervais Rioux: leadership, an unflagging determination in his every effort as well as an undying passion for his sport. These qualities have remained undiminished in his current role as cycle designer and company CEO.
In buying a Montreal bike shop at the close of his racing career, Gervais chose to put his vision of cycling to work in serving his customers. Thanks to this vision, the shop became an eastern Canadian authority in matters of road cycling and bike fit. More than 2000 bike fitting sessions took place in the store between 1990 and 1999. Alongside these developments, the house brand bike, the Argon 18, began attracting increasing attention everywhere in Canada, for its impeccable handling, quality fabrication and refined, detailed finish.

1999: A TURNING POINT
The year 1999 marked a turning point for the fledgling company; that’s when Argon 18 bicycles first appeared at Interbike and soon after became available everywhere in North America. This was extended to Europe the following year, and then to Asia and Oceania. Soon, Gervais Rioux, who by now was primarily occupied with bike design, began working with a material of almost unlimited potential: carbon fiber.
This development work eventually yielded the Helium, the first full carbon frameset to bear the Argon 18 name.



ARGON 18 WON TRIPLE WORLD CHAMPION HONORS

A watershed of a different type occurred in 2006, when Argon 18 won triple world champion honors thanks to the considerable athletic talents of Canadian Samantha McGlone (Ironman 70.3) as well as Torbjorn Sindballe and Bella Comerford (LD Triathlon World Championships).

CORIMA S.A. was founded in 1973 by Pierre MARTIN and Jean-Marie RIFFARD and is based in Loriol sur Drôme in France. Its initial activities were in mechanical molding: the making of moulds and models for the foundry, automobile and aeronautics sectors. In 1988, CORIMA diversified into the production of carbon composite parts and launched its first product for the cycling sector: the “Disc Wheel”. This was followed by many other products which now create a full range of carbon products for cyclingCORIMA has always worked with cycling professionals on both the track and road racing circuits to help develop its product range. Our products have been involved in many prestigious victories and setting of new records around the world and continue to do so with numerous athletes.
